WebA finishing oil is a vegetable oil used for wood finishing. These finishes are a historical finish for wood, primarily as means of making it weather or moisture resistant. ... The two most important finishing oils, to this day, are linseed oil and tung oil. Linseed oil is extracted from the seeds of the flax plant, ... WebLinseed oil for wood, which is made from flaxseed, is one of the most popular wood finishes. It provides a satin finish and brings out the natural color and woodgrain while helping to protect against scratches and moisture.
